[hr]1.  Basic InfoDate proposed:  August 2, 2013Name of the sponsor(s):  Bill BartlettNames of the confirming GP members, if needed, with their confirmation emails:2.  Title:  Proposal to create a Fundraising Committee. 3.  Text of the actual Proposal: The primary function of the Fundraising Committee shall be quarterly fundraising drives to shore up state coffers and provide materials and funds for outreach, candidates and issues as needed.  Suggested Timeline for Fundraising – (March - June - September – December)Funding Advertising materials will be created in cooperation with the Outreach Committee.  Access to social media and web media will be provided in cooperation with the Website Committee.  Any additional funding needed to operate fundraising operations should be directed to the Outreach Committee or the State Council. Auditing and OversightAll revenues and expenses must be presented to the council at the end of each three month period.  At any time during this period, the committee must be prepared to present an accounting of revenues and expenses to date and any results related to those transactions. MembershipThe members of the Outreach Committee must meet all criteria designated in the bylaws.  Committee members are expected to serve for terms of one year, to be approved in a manner determined in the party bylaws.  The Outreach Committee will be comprised of three members of leadership (2 chairs, secretary) and two staffers (researchers/clerks).  The three leaders are to be appointed as committee chairs as per the GPCO Bylaws, the remaining staff are to be appointed by the committee itself per its own procedures.  One of the original chairs is to be appointed for an initial six month term, allowing for staggered rotating of officers.  The beginning team members have yet to be determined.  Suggestions might include Bill Kinsey and Laura Clark as Chairs, with one of them choosing who would serve the first six-month term. 4. Background:  The party hasn’t had a Fundraising Committee in a long time.  5. Justification/Goals:  This Committee’s work will bring in funds for future party operations.  It will also spread awareness of the party.  6. Pros and Cons:  n/a7.
